Hackers Add Further Twist to Online Casino Crash

07/20/2010
  

A further twist to yesterday’s story about the high profile crash of online casino site PlayNow.com emerged this morning amidst speculation that it may have been hackers, not eager customers, that caused the site’s servers to overload.

British Columbia’s New Democratic Party have raised concerns that players’ personal information may have been compromised as a result of the site going down and have criticised PlayNow.com for their reluctance to issue a statement about the incident.

The British Columbia Lottery Corporation originally insisted that unexpectedly high traffic generated by the launch of the new site was responsible for the server crashing, but the NDP have since suggested that the site may well have been hacked instead.

“Experts have made an assertion that hacking was a possibility,” said the NDP’s Shane Simpson, though he provided no hard evidence to support his claims. “But the most concerning thing is that the government and BCLC have not been definitive that there wasn’t some kind of activity that breached the security of the site”.

It has been speculated that hackers may have intentionally overloaded the site by using bots to generate excess traffic, allowing them to then mine for data once the servers were down – but as of yet there has been no proof to support these claims.

In the meantime Rich Coleman, Minister of Housing and Social Development who is also responsible for BCLC, assured PlayNow.com customers that the matter would be looked into immediately and that the site would be up and running again very soon.

“It does appear that some information – because of all the data hitting at once – might have been displayed on somebody’s computer, so we are dealing with that,” he said.
